Job description

We are seeking a proactive, organised digital communicator who enjoys variety and thrives in a dynamic environment. You’ll own our social media, lead and deliver digital and community fundraising campaigns, and help grow and engage audiences with bold, positive and emotive content. You’ll keep projects moving, uphold brand standards, and collaborate confidently across teams. 

About Spinal Research 

Every two hours, someone in the UK becomes paralysed. Globally, more than 15 million people live with paralysis. At Spinal Research, our vision is a world where paralysis can be cured. We fund groundbreaking research to deliver life-changing treatments for people with spinal cord injuries. By backing the brightest minds and fostering innovation, we are driving progress towards what could be the medical breakthrough of the 21st century: curing paralysis. We will not stop until that future is achieved. 

Key Responsibilities 

  • Lead social media strategy and engagement across Meta, Instagram, LinkedIn, and YouTube; manage calendar, publishing, housekeeping and audience engagement. 

  • Stay abreast of developments in social media channels, trends and tools, and proactively explore new platforms and features for audience growth and engagement. 

  • Produce clear social media performance reports with actionable insights. 

  • Build and optimise paid social campaigns for awareness, acquisition and income. 

  • Create digital assets: infographics, graphics, and short-form video (Reels/Shorts). 

  • Source, shape and publish supporter stories and web news items. 

  • Ensure brand consistency and tone of voice across all outputs; support brand sign-off and content request workflows. 

  • Identify, test, and fully implement new digital and community fundraising opportunities; lead discovery and delivery for audience targeted products (e.g., motorsport fundraising). 

  • Collaborate confidently across teams to align priorities, timelines and standards. 

  • Assist with in-house training (social best practice, content creation, platform processes, ad creation). 

  • Future scope: The role may expand to include additional communications activities. 

The kind of person we are looking for: 

Essential criteria 

  • At least a year’s proven experience in a relevant role within a charity setting. 

  • In-depth, up-to-date knowledge of social media platforms and campaigns, including planning, processes and scheduling tools (e.g., content calendars, workflow management, and best practice for engagement). 

  • Experience creating and managing paid ad campaigns on social media (e.g., Meta Ads Manager; audience targeting, creative testing, optimisation, reporting). 

  • Proficiency in creating digital content, including video and image editing (e.g., Canva, After Effects, Photoshop, InDesign, Premiere Pro). 

  • Excellent collaboration and teamwork skills. 

  • Excellent written and verbal communication skills across messaging, grammar, punctuation,tone and style. 

  • Understanding of supporter/donor care. 

  • High motivation skills and the ability to manage multiple projects confidently and keep momentum. 

  • Able to attend the London office one day per week (can be more if preferred) and to attend key events throughout the year. 

Desirable 

  • Experience in community and or digital fundraising. 

  • Experience sourcing and presenting supporter stories. 

  • Experience using a website CMS (e.g., WordPress or equivalent). 

  • Basic web page creation/maintenance. 

  • Experience of working within a medical research charity setting. 

Personal Attributes 

  • Proactive, resilient, and adaptable, with a growth mindset. 

  • Highly organised, detail-oriented, and able to manage multiple priorities. 

  • Passionate about making a positive impact for people affected by spinal cord injury. 

Working Arrangements 

  • Hybrid role split between home and our London Bridge office. 

  • Spinal Research is a four-day week employer. 

  • Part of a supportive, values-driven team (commitment, integrity, collaboration, innovation). 

  • Occasional evening or weekend work may be required to support organisational priorities.
